肠移植早期黏膜地址素细胞黏附分子在大鼠移植小肠及其肠系膜淋巴结的表达

摘    要:目的 探讨黏膜地址素细胞黏附分子(MAdCAM-1)在大鼠小肠移植早期移植肠及其肠系膜淋巴结中的表达及意义。方法 选用近交系F344/N和BN大鼠建立全小肠异位移植模型后分3组:第1组,非手术对照组(F344/N);第2组,同基因移植组(F344/N→F344/N);第3组,异基因移植组(BN→F344/N)。术后1、3、5、7d取各组移植肠及其肠系膜淋巴结检测MAdCAM-1表达的分布及变化,同期进行移植肠组织病理学检查。结果 同基因移植组各检测时点的肠黏膜组织表现与正常小肠的组织学特征基本相同;异基因移植组肠黏膜组织表现符合轻-中-重度排斥反应的渐进过程,2周后移植肠绒毛变的低平,散在黏膜上皮脱落,移植肠相关肠系膜淋巴结萎缩明显。MAdCAM-1在急性排斥反应期,高表达于移植肠固有层及其肠系膜淋巴结,特别是高表达于肠黏膜固有层中的扁平血管内皮细胞表面。同基因移植组术后MAdCAM-1的表达在1—7d均无明显量的变化;而异基因移植组MAdCAM-1在移植肠中的表达呈上升趋势,而在其肠系膜淋巴结中的表达呈下降趋势。结论 MAdCAM-1与小肠移植急性排斥反应的进展关系密切。

Expression of mucosal addressin cell adhesion molecule-1 during small bowel graft rejection in rat

Abstract:Objective To investigate the expression of mucosal addressin cell adhesion molecule-1(MAdCAM-1) during small bowel graft rejection and the effects of MAdCAM-1 on the development of acute rejection.Methods Rat heterotopic small bowel transplantation (SBT) was performed in F344/N rats with syngeneic and allogeneic (BN-F344/N) grafts.Bowel and gut-associated lymphoid tissue(GALT) samples were collected from small bowel transplants on postoperative day (POD) 1,3,5 and 7. Histopathology assessment of the grafts was conducted to identify the rejection.MAdCAM-1 was detected by immunohistochemistry and Western blot.Results During acute rejection,MAdCAM-1 was highly- expressed on gut lamina propia and GALTs,particularly on vascular endothelial cells in the gut lamina propia.There were no change of MAdCAM-1 expression in syngeneic grafts from PODI to POD7.In allogeneie grafts,MAdCAM-1 expression in mesenteric lymph nodes was down-regulated,while up-regulated on the vascular endothelial cells in the lamina propria during acute rejection.Conclusion Alteration of MAdCAM-1 expression may be associated with the development of SBT graft rejection.
